Bihar: Death Toll Reaches to 8 in Vaishali Accident

Guwahati: As many as eight people have been killed as a result of the tragedy that occurred on Sunday in Vaishali of Bihar, according to a government official on Monday.

Earlier it was claimed that a truck had rammed into a roadside encampment in the Mehnar area of Vaishali which resulted in killing at least seven children.

According to District Magistrate, Vaishali, Yash Pal Meena, four injured persons are undergoing treatment.

“The death toll reported so far is eight, four injured are still under treatment. State Government has announced an ex-gratia of Rs 5 lakhs for the kin of the deceased. The injured are being provided treatment,” he said.

Earlier today, Chief Minister Nitish Kumar expressed sorrow over the deaths caused by the tragedy in Vaishali and made an ex-gratia announcement for the surviving family members of the deceased.

According to reports, the Chief Minister announced an ex-gratia of Rs 5 lakh for the families of the deceased.

“I am pained by the incident of a speeding truck crushing many people including children in the Desari police station area of Vaishali. Deep sympathy for the relatives of the deceased. They will be given an ex-gratia grant of Rs 5 lakh each. Instructed for proper treatment of the injured. Wishing them a speedy recovery,” Kumar tweeted in Hindi in the early hours of Monday.

President Droupadi Murmu also sent her sympathies to the families of those who lost loved ones in the Vaishali traffic disaster earlier on Sunday.

“The news of several casualties including children in a road accident in Vaishali, Bihar is extremely painful. I express my deepest condolences to the families who lost their loved ones in this accident and wish a speedy recovery to the injured,” tweeted Rashtrapati Bhavan in Hindi.

The accident’s fatalities were also mourned by Prime Minister Narendra Modi. From the PMNRF (Prime Minister’s National Relief Fund), he approved ex-gratia payments of Rs 2 lakhs for each of the surviving relatives of those who died and Rs 50,000 for those who were injured.

“The accident in Vaishali, Bihar is saddening. Condolences to the bereaved families. May the injured recover soon. An ex-gratia of Rs 2 lakh from PMNRF would be given to the next of kin of each deceased. The injured would be given Rs 50,000,” tweeted Prime Minister’s Office.
